Can Guinea Pigs Have Rabbit Pellets. Rabbits can safely eat guinea pig food, including guinea pig pellets and snacks. Their diets are extremely similar, both being mainly based on hay. Rabbit pellets may contain harmful ingredients like seeds or nuts that can have detrimental effects on your guinea pig’s health. That said, you should never entirely replace a rabbit’s diet with a guinea pig’s pellets. Rabbits can eat guinea pig food occasionally if you are currently unable to get rabbit food for your little friend. Rabbits and guinea pigs can both eat the same hay, most commonly timothy and meadow, with hay making up the majority of. The reason for this is that guinea pigs have a higher need for vitamin c,. Furthermore, rabbit pellets do not contain enough fiber and protein, as rabbits need less of these nutrients than guinea pigs do. The main difference is that guinea pig pellets have extra vitamin c added, which bunnies don’t need but guinea pigs do. Prevent these issues by carefully checking the package.
